 I am trying to extract natural orbital cube files for my Gaussian 09
 (revision D.01) UHF broken-symmetry open-shell singlet calculation.
 For H2 (with a separation of 2.0 ang, to make the system spin-polarized),
 the instructions given in the manual of gaussian
 (https://gaussian.com/population/) work well. The input I was
 using is
 ~~~
 %NProcShared=4
 %Mem=8192MB
 %chk=a.chk
 #p uhf/6-311+G(d,p)
 scf=(maxcycle=2048)
 int=superfine
 guess=(mix)
 sp
 h2
 0 1
 H 0.0 0.0 0.0
 H 2.0 0.0 0.0
 --link1--
 %NProcShared=4
 %Mem=8192MB
 %chk=a.chk
 # Guess=(Only,save,NaturalOrbitals) Geom=AllCheck ChkBasis
 ~~~
 When I try to do the same thing for nonacene, I get the dreaded error of
 (in gaussian output log):
 ~~~
 ..
 Initial guess natural orbitals from previous density.
  Operation on file out of range.
  FileIO: IOper= 2 IFilNo(1)= -2551 Len=      937024 IPos=           0 Q=
 47406787346360
  dumping /fiocom/,
  ...
  ~~~
  These are the things I tried that didn't work:
  * Increasing memory considerably
  * Using IOP(3/32=2)
  * Using "Guess=(read,Save,Only,NaturalOrbitals) Geom=AllCheck
 ChkBasis"
  * Using "Guess=(Save,Only,NaturalOrbitals) pop=naturalorbitals
 Geom=AllCheck ChkBasis"
  * combinations of the previously mentioned points
 Has anybody encountered and solved this problem? I saw somewhere that
 updating to revision E could help but that's unfortunately not a
 possiblity.
